Overview of Hitch Installer
A Hitch Installer is a professional who specializes in the installation of hitches and related equipment on vehicles. This job requires a strong understanding of vehicle mechanics, as well as the ability to follow detailed instructions and safety protocols. Hitch Installers work in a variety of settings, including automotive repair shops, trailer dealerships, and even in mobile units that travel to customers' locations. The job can be physically demanding, as it often involves lifting heavy equipment and working in tight spaces. However, it can also be very rewarding, as it allows Hitch Installers to help customers safely and securely transport their belongings or equipment.
Hitch Installers must be knowledgeable about a wide range of hitches and towing equipment, including weight distribution systems, fifth wheel hitches, and gooseneck hitches. They must also be familiar with the different types of vehicles that can accommodate these hitches, such as trucks, SUVs, and vans. In addition to installing hitches, Hitch Installers may also be responsible for performing maintenance and repairs on existing equipment, as well as providing customers with advice on the best type of hitch for their needs.
